@charset "UTF-8";.w-e-text-container h1,.w-e-text-container h2,.w-e-text-container h3,.w-e-text-container h4,.w-e-text-container h5,.w-e-text-container h6{font-size:revert}.w-e-scroll:focus-within+.w-e-text-placeholder:before{position:absolute;content:"";top:5px;left:0;bottom:5px;width:1px;background-color:#000;animation:opt 1s infinite}@keyframes opt{0%{opacity:1}50%{opacity:0}to{opacity:1}}body,h1,h2,h3,h4,h5,h6,hr,p,blockquote,pre,dl,dt,dd,ul,ol,li,form,button,input,textarea,fieldset,legend,th,td,figure{margin:0;padding:0}body,a,button,input,select,textarea,code{color:#333;line-height:22px;font-size:14px;font-family:微软雅黑,Arial}a{display:inline-block;text-decoration:none}span,em,i{display:inline-block;font-style:normal}h1,h2,h3,h4,h5,h6{font-size:100%;font-weight:400}ul,ol{list-style:none}table{border-collapse:collapse;border-spacing:0}.clearfix:after{visibility:hidden;display:block;clear:both;height:0;content:""}hr{display:block;border:none;height:1px}blockquote,q{quotes:none}blockquote:before,blockquote:after,q:before,q:after{content:""}@font-face{font-family:iconfont;src:url(/assets/woff2/iconfont-DwGKlyij.woff2?t=1706703907404) format("woff2"),url(/assets/woff/iconfont-DWDiUdTF.woff?t=1706703907404) format("woff"),url(/assets/ttf/iconfont-Bqw7tNUv.ttf?t=1706703907404) format("truetype")}.iconfont{font-family:iconfont!important;font-size:16px;font-style:normal;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}.icon-ip:before{content:""}.icon-shichang:before{content:""}.icon-duanxin:before{content:""}.icon-shouji:before{content:""}.icon-shuaxin:before{content:""}.icon-renzheng:before{content:""}.icon-shenpi:before{content:""}.icon-shipin:before{content:""}.icon-weixin:before{content:""}.icon-dingdan2:before{content:""}.icon-chongzhi:before{content:""}.icon-tongxunlu:before{content:""}.icon-rili:before{content:""}.icon-backtop:before{content:""}.icon-tuichudenglu:before{content:""}.icon-user:before{content:""}.icon-muban:before{content:""}.icon-shenhe:before{content:""}.icon-dingdan:before{content:""}.icon-quanxianguanli:before{content:""}.icon-shouye:before{content:""}.icon-shangchuan:before{content:""}.icon-caogaoxiang:before{content:""}.icon-asterisk:before{content:""}.icon-jifen2:before{content:""}.icon-lianjie:before{content:""}.icon-base-station:before{content:""}.icon-chaxun:before{content:""}.icon-bodadianhua:before{content:""}.icon-jifen:before{content:""}.icon-jilu:before{content:""}.icon-daibanshixiang:before{content:""}.icon-touxiang:before{content:""}.icon-arrow-left:before{content:""}.icon-wenjianjia:before{content:""}.icon-arrow-right:before{content:""}.icon-arrow-top:before{content:""}.icon-arrow-bottom:before{content:""}.icon-guanbi2:before{content:""}.icon-guanbi:before{content:""}.icon-kejian:before{content:""}.icon-bukejian:before{content:""}.icon-jiesuo:before{content:""}.icon-fuwuqi:before{content:""}.icon-fuwuqi2:before{content:""}.icon-user2:before{content:""}.icon-huiyiliebiao:before{content:""}.icon-setting:before{content:""}.icon-juese:before{content:""}.icon-menu:before{content:""}.icon-yonghu:before{content:""}.icon-yonghu2:before{content:""}.icon-chanpinshebei:before{content:""}.icon-wendang:before{content:""}.icon-jizhan:before{content:""}.icon-ditudingwei:before{content:""}.login-wrapper{display:flex;align-items:center;justify-content:center;width:100%;min-height:100vh;padding:10px;background:linear-gradient(130deg,#4ec0a7,#777fbe 95%);box-sizing:border-box}.login-news{display:flex;align-items:center;justify-content:center;width:800px;min-height:600px;padding:30px;margin-right:5%;background:linear-gradient(130deg,#4ec0a7,#777fbe 95%);color:#fff;font-size:36px;text-indent:2em;box-sizing:border-box;border-radius:30px}.login-form{width:400px;padding:30px;background:#fff;box-sizing:border-box;border-radius:5px}.login-form h3{margin-bottom:40px;text-align:center;font-size:28px;line-height:1}.login-form .el-form-item{margin-bottom:30px}.login-form .el-col:last-of-type .el-form-item{margin-bottom:0}.login-form .line .el-form-item__content{flex-wrap:nowrap}.login-form .line .el-form-item__content .suffix{display:flex;flex-shrink:0;margin-left:10px}.login-form .button .el-button{width:100%}.login-form .button .way{display:flex;justify-content:space-between;width:100%;margin-top:15px}.login-form .button .way .el-text{font-size:16px;line-height:1;cursor:pointer}.login-form .el-input__prefix-inner .prefix{display:flex;align-items:center;margin-right:15px}.login-form .captcha .el-input-group__append{padding:0}.login-form .captcha .el-input-group__append .icd{overflow:hidden;width:120px;height:40px;border-radius:0 4px 4px 0;cursor:pointer}.login-form .captcha .el-input-group__append .icd .el-image{width:100%;height:100%}.login-form .captcha .el-input-group__append .icd img{max-width:100%;max-height:100%}.login-form .support{flex:1;text-align:center;line-height:1}.layout-wrapper{display:flex;width:100%;height:100vh}.layout-content{overflow:hidden;display:flex;flex-direction:column;flex:1}.layout-vertical{overflow-y:hidden;display:flex;flex-direction:column;flex:1;padding:10px;background:#f5f9ff;box-sizing:border-box}.layout-vertical>.el-loading-mask{top:10px;right:10px;bottom:10px;left:10px;border-radius:5px}.layout-horizontal{display:flex;width:100%;height:100%}.layout-scroll{flex:1;padding:10px;background:#f5f9ff;box-sizing:border-box}.null-data{padding:10px 0;color:#999;text-align:center;box-sizing:border-box}.menu-custom.el-menu,.menu-sub-popup.el-menu{width:220px;background:transparent;border:none;-webkit-user-select:none;user-select:none}.menu-custom .el-menu,.menu-sub-popup .el-menu{background:#304156}.menu-custom .el-menu-item,.menu-custom .el-sub-menu__title,.menu-sub-popup .el-menu-item,.menu-sub-popup .el-sub-menu__title{height:50px;font-size:14px;line-height:1}.menu-custom .el-menu-item:hover,.menu-custom .el-menu-item:focus,.menu-custom .el-sub-menu__title:hover,.menu-custom .el-sub-menu__title:focus,.menu-sub-popup .el-menu-item:hover,.menu-sub-popup .el-menu-item:focus,.menu-sub-popup .el-sub-menu__title:hover,.menu-sub-popup .el-sub-menu__title:focus{background:#00152899}.menu-custom .el-menu-item .iconfont,.menu-custom .el-sub-menu__title .iconfont,.menu-sub-popup .el-menu-item .iconfont,.menu-sub-popup .el-sub-menu__title .iconfont{color:#bfcbd9;font-size:20px}.menu-custom .el-menu-item .el-icon,.menu-custom .el-sub-menu__title .el-icon,.menu-sub-popup .el-menu-item .el-icon,.menu-sub-popup .el-sub-menu__title .el-icon{color:#bfcbd9}.menu-custom .el-menu-item .title,.menu-custom .el-sub-menu__title .title,.menu-sub-popup .el-menu-item .title,.menu-sub-popup .el-sub-menu__title .title{overflow:hidden;color:#bfcbd9;margin-left:20px}.menu-custom .el-menu-item.is-active,.menu-sub-popup .el-menu-item.is-active{background:#001528}.menu-custom .el-menu-item.is-active .iconfont,.menu-sub-popup .el-menu-item.is-active .iconfont,.menu-custom .el-menu-item.is-active .title,.menu-sub-popup .el-menu-item.is-active .title{color:#fff}.menu-custom.el-menu--collapse,.menu-sub-popup.el-menu--collapse{width:60px}.menu-custom.el-menu--collapse .el-sub-menu.is-active,.menu-sub-popup.el-menu--collapse .el-sub-menu.is-active{background:#001528}.menu-custom.el-menu--collapse .el-sub-menu.is-active .iconfont,.menu-sub-popup.el-menu--collapse .el-sub-menu.is-active .iconfont,.menu-custom.el-menu--collapse .el-sub-menu.is-active .title,.menu-sub-popup.el-menu--collapse .el-sub-menu.is-active .title{color:#fff}.table-query{display:flex;justify-content:space-between;flex-wrap:wrap;flex-shrink:0;padding:10px 10px 0 0;background:#fff;border-radius:5px 5px 0 0}.table-query+.table-custom{border-radius:0 0 5px 5px}.table-query .query-header{display:flex;align-items:center;justify-content:space-between;margin-bottom:20px}.table-query .query-header .name{padding-left:10px}.table-query .query-header .name h3{font-size:16px}.table-query .form-custom{display:flex}.table-query .el-form{display:flex;align-items:center;flex-wrap:wrap;flex:1}.table-query .el-form-item{padding-left:10px;margin-bottom:10px}.table-query .el-form-item .el-form-item__label{padding-right:5px}.table-query .el-input,.table-query .el-select{width:215px!important}.table-query .el-date-editor--daterange{width:280px!important}.table-query .el-date-editor--datetimerange{width:400px!important}.table-query .flex{display:flex;flex-wrap:wrap}.table-query .table-query-right{display:flex;align-items:flex-end;flex-shrink:0;padding:0 0 10px 10px}.table-custom{overflow:auto;display:flex;flex-direction:column;flex:1;padding:10px;background:#fff;border-radius:5px;box-sizing:border-box}.table-custom .table-header{display:flex;align-items:center;justify-content:space-between;flex-shrink:0;margin-bottom:10px}.table-custom .table-header .name h3{font-size:16px}.table-custom .table-header .edit{display:flex;align-items:center}.table-custom .table-header .edit p{margin-right:30px}.table-custom .el-table .el-table__body tr.hover-row.current-row>td.el-table__cell,.table-custom .el-table .el-table__body tr.hover-row.el-table__row--striped.current-row>td.el-table__cell,.table-custom .el-table .el-table__body tr.hover-row.el-table__row--striped>td.el-table__cell,.table-custom .el-table .el-table__body tr.hover-row>td.el-table__cell{background:#f5f9ff}.table-custom .el-table .cell{line-height:22px;padding:0 5px}.table-custom .el-table .el-table__cell{height:40px;padding:5px 0}.table-custom .el-table thead tr th{height:40px!important;background:#f5f9ff!important}.table-custom .el-table .el-scrollbar__bar{right:1px;bottom:1px}.table-custom .el-table .el-scrollbar__bar.is-vertical{width:10px}.table-custom .el-table .el-scrollbar__bar.is-horizontal{height:10px}.table-custom .el-table .content{display:flex;align-items:center;justify-content:center;overflow:hidden;white-space:nowrap;text-overflow:ellipsis}.table-custom .preview{overflow:hidden;width:50px;height:40px;margin:0 auto;line-height:1;border-radius:5px;cursor:pointer}.table-custom .preview .el-image{display:block;width:100%;height:100%}.table-custom .preview .el-image__error{font-size:12px}.table-custom .handle .el-button{margin:0 5px}.dialog-overlay-custom .el-overlay-dialog{display:flex;align-items:center;padding:0 5px}.dialog-custom{margin:0 auto!important}.dialog-custom.dialog-body-height-fixed .layout-vertical{height:100%;padding:0;background:transparent}.dialog-custom.dialog-body-height-fixed .layout-vertical>.el-loading-mask{top:0;right:0;bottom:0;left:0}.dialog-custom.dialog-body-height-fixed .el-dialog__body{height:560px;max-height:560px}.dialog-custom .table-query,.dialog-custom .table-custom{padding:0}.dialog-custom .el-dialog__header{position:sticky;top:0;z-index:3;margin:0;padding:10px;border-bottom:1px solid #EFF1F5;border-radius:5px 5px 0 0}.dialog-custom .el-dialog__header .el-dialog__title{font-size:16px}.dialog-custom .el-dialog__headerbtn{top:12px;right:10px;z-index:5;width:auto;height:auto;font-size:20px}.dialog-custom .el-dialog__body{position:relative;overflow-y:auto;max-height:80vh;padding:20px;box-sizing:border-box}.dialog-custom .el-dialog__footer{position:sticky;bottom:0;z-index:3;padding:10px;border-top:1px solid #EFF1F5;border-radius:0 0 5px 5px}.dialog-custom .dialog-footer-between{display:flex;justify-content:space-between}.form-custom .el-form.el-form--label-top .el-form-item__label{display:inline-block;height:auto;margin-bottom:3px!important}.form-custom .el-form .el-form-item .el-form-item__error{padding-top:1px;line-height:1.1}.form-custom .el-form .el-form-item .el-select,.form-custom .el-form .el-form-item .el-date-editor,.form-custom .el-form .el-form-item .el-input__wrapper{width:100%;box-sizing:border-box}.form-custom .el-form .el-form-item .el-input-number{width:100%}.form-custom .el-form .el-form-item .el-input-number .el-input__wrapper{padding-left:11px}.form-custom .el-form .el-form-item .el-input-number .el-input__inner{text-align:left}.form-custom .el-form .getmap{position:absolute;right:0;bottom:0;line-height:1;transform:translateY(100%)}.form-custom .el-form .el-input.is-disabled .el-input__wrapper{background:#f8f9fa}.tree-custom{width:100%}.tree-custom .tree-header{display:flex;align-items:center}.tree-custom .tree-header>*{margin-right:10px}.tree-custom .tree-header .el-button:last-of-type{margin-right:0}.tree-custom .tree-header-custom{display:flex;align-items:center}.tree-custom .tree-header-custom>*{margin-right:10px}.tree-custom .el-tree{overflow-y:auto;height:100%;margin-top:10px;background:transparent}.tree-custom .el-tree .el-tree-node__content:hover{background:#ddd}.tree-custom .el-tree.el-tree--highlight-current .is-current>.el-tree-node__content{background:#ddd}.tree-custom .el-tree .el-tree-node__label{overflow:hidden}.tree-custom .el-tree-node__expand-icon{padding:3px!important;font-size:20px!important}.tree-custom .tree-content{display:flex;align-items:center;justify-content:space-between;flex:1}.tree-custom .tree-label-ellipsis{overflow:hidden;white-space:nowrap;text-overflow:ellipsis}.tree-custom .handle{padding:0 10px;box-sizing:border-box}.tree-custom .handle .el-button{height:auto;padding:0;background:transparent!important}.tree-custom .handle .el-button:hover{opacity:.7}.page-custom[data-v-f1341aa2]{display:flex;flex-wrap:wrap;align-items:center;justify-content:flex-end;flex-shrink:0;margin-top:10px;background:#fff;box-sizing:border-box}.page-custom[data-v-f1341aa2] .el-pagination{overflow-x:auto;padding:0}.page-custom[data-v-f1341aa2] .el-pagination .el-pagination__total{margin-right:10px}.page-custom[data-v-f1341aa2] .el-pagination .el-pagination__jump{margin-left:10px}.page-custom[data-v-f1341aa2] .el-pagination .el-pagination__sizes{margin-right:10px}.page-custom[data-v-f1341aa2] .el-pagination .el-select .el-input{width:100px}.upload-image-wrapper[data-v-649d2d31]{display:flex;align-items:center;flex-wrap:wrap;width:100%}.upload-image-list[data-v-649d2d31]{display:flex;padding:2px 0}.upload-image-list li[data-v-649d2d31]{overflow:hidden;position:relative;width:50px;height:30px;margin:0 3px 3px 0;border-radius:4px;cursor:pointer}.upload-image-list li img[data-v-649d2d31]{width:100%;height:100%;object-fit:cover}.upload-image-list li .el-icon[data-v-649d2d31]{position:absolute;top:0;left:0;z-index:1;padding:1px 3px;border:1px solid #65c100;background:#fff;color:#65c100;border-radius:4px 0}.upload-image-list li .el-icon[data-v-649d2d31]:hover{border-color:#fff;background:#65c100;color:#fff}.upload-button[data-v-649d2d31]{display:flex;margin:0 3px 3px 0}.upload-button .el-button[data-v-649d2d31]{width:50px;height:30px;border-style:dashed}.upload-button .el-button[data-v-649d2d31]:hover{border-color:#999}.upload-button .el-button:hover .el-icon[data-v-649d2d31]{color:#999}.upload-button .el-button .el-icon[data-v-649d2d31]{color:#ccc;font-size:18px}.el-image-viewer__wrapper{-webkit-user-select:none;user-select:none}.el-image-viewer__wrapper:focus-visible{outline:none}.el-image-viewer__wrapper .el-image-viewer__btn{background:#fff;color:#666;font-size:28px;box-shadow:0 0 5px #0003}.el-image-viewer__wrapper .el-image-viewer__actions__inner{color:#666}.menu-wrapper[data-v-70d56607]{position:relative;z-index:3;overflow-x:hidden;flex-shrink:0;background:#304156;box-shadow:5px 0 10px #00000026}.menu-logo[data-v-70d56607]{position:relative;width:100%;height:50px;box-sizing:border-box;border-bottom:1px solid #29394d;box-shadow:0 1px 1px #0000000a}.menu-logo .logo[data-v-70d56607]{position:absolute;top:0;right:0;width:100%;height:100%;display:flex;align-items:center;justify-content:center}.menu-logo img[data-v-70d56607]{width:30px;height:30px;border-radius:5px}.menu-logo a[data-v-70d56607]{color:#bfcbd9;white-space:nowrap;font-size:16px;font-weight:500;margin-left:5px}.header-wrapper[data-v-2370651e]{display:flex;align-items:center;justify-content:space-between;flex-shrink:0;height:50px;padding:0 20px;box-sizing:border-box;border-bottom:1px solid #f1f1f1;box-shadow:0 1px 1px #0000000a}.operation[data-v-2370651e]{padding-right:20px}.operation .el-icon[data-v-2370651e]{font-size:24px;cursor:pointer}.info-handle[data-v-2370651e]{display:flex;align-items:center}.info-handle .notice[data-v-2370651e]{position:relative;margin-right:20px}.info-handle .trigger[data-v-2370651e]{cursor:pointer;color:#637785;font-size:14px}.info-handle .trigger[data-v-2370651e]:focus-visible{outline:none}
